How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Buena Vista Area?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Buena Vista Area Studio Apartments | $2,365 | $1,750 | $6,448 |
Buena Vista Area 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,759 | $1,800 | $7,423 |
Buena Vista Area 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,344 | $2,150 | $10,000+ |
Buena Vista Area 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,337 | $3,204 | $9,265 |

Getting Around the Buena Vista Area Neighborhood in Walnut Creek, CA
Walk Score®
57 / 100
Somewhat Walkable
Some err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
46 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
42 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
